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Compressed air dryers remove moisture generated during compression, preventing condensation, corrosion, pipework damage and defects in pneumatic tools or finished products. This improves system reliability, reduces maintenance costs and ensures consistent air quality.

Choose a dryer based on your air flow rate (SCFM/L/min), operating pressure and required pressure dew point. Undersized dryers may fail to remove moisture effectively, leading to condensation downstream. Consult technical specifications or an expert to match dryer capacity with your compressor’s output.

Regular tasks include checking and replacing filters, monitoring dew point output, draining condensate and following manufacturer-recommended service intervals. Proper maintenance ensures peak performance and extends equipment life.

Energy use depends on dryer type: refrigerated dryers typically consume moderate power, while desiccant dryers may use more due to regeneration cycles. Choose energy-efficient models, ensure proper sizing and optimise system pressure to reduce power consumption and lifecycle costs.
